Former Chelsea legend John Terry 'set to make first managerial breakthrough' and join Saudi Pro League side Al-Shabab

Former Chelsea legend John Terry is 'set to make first managerial breakthrough' by joining Saudi Pro League side Al-Shabab.

According to the Sun, Terry was approached by the Saudi club two months ago and a deal has already been verbally agreed.

The 42-year-old has been offered an inital contract of at least two years, but this could go up to four years should the deal be finalised.

Terry would join a host of former Premier League stars in the Saudi Pro League, including former England teammate Steven Gerrard who currently manages Al-Ettifaq.
